Q2: Why is cable quality so important in machinery monitoring systems?
A: In condition monitoring applications, the signals being transmitted are extremely low-level and highly sensitive to external interference. Any degradation in cable quality—such as poor shielding, inconsistent conductor performance, or weak connectors—can introduce noise, attenuation, or signal distortion. This directly impacts the accuracy of vibration analysis and machinery diagnostics. High-quality interconnecting cables like the 130539-20 are engineered to maintain signal integrity even in harsh industrial environments where electromagnetic interference, electrical noise, and mechanical vibration are constantly present. This ensures that the monitoring system receives clean, accurate data for reliable machine health assessment.

Q4: How does shielding improve performance in industrial environments?
A: Shielding is one of the most important design features in this type of cable. Industrial environments are filled with sources of electromagnetic interference, such as variable frequency drives, switching power supplies, and high-voltage electrical equipment. Without proper shielding, these external signals can couple into the measurement circuit and corrupt the sensor data. The shielding in the 130539-20 cable acts as a protective barrier that blocks unwanted electromagnetic noise, ensuring that only the true measurement signal is transmitted. This significantly improves data accuracy, stability, and repeatability in long-term monitoring applications.

Q6: What should be considered during installation of this cable?
A: Proper installation is essential to maintain signal quality and long-term reliability. The cable should be routed away from high-voltage power cables and strong electromagnetic sources to minimize interference. It should not be subjected to excessive bending, tension, or mechanical stress, as this could damage the internal conductors or shielding layer. Connectors must be properly secured to ensure stable electrical contact. In addition, proper grounding of the shielding system is critical to maximize noise immunity and maintain signal integrity in electrically noisy environments.

Q8: What maintenance practices are recommended for long-term reliability?
A: Although the cable is designed for long-term industrial use with minimal maintenance requirements, periodic inspection is still recommended as part of a comprehensive condition monitoring program. Maintenance activities should include checking connector tightness, inspecting cable insulation for signs of wear or aging, and verifying that cable routing has not been disturbed. It is also important to ensure that shielding and grounding connections remain intact, as any degradation in these areas can increase susceptibility to electrical noise. Regular visual inspections combined with system signal validation help ensure continuous and reliable performance of the monitoring system.
